What should I wear / Bring to class ?
You should always be comfortable in what you wear to class. We recommend shorts and a t-shirt or tank top for your first class. The more skin, the better you stick to the pole. We recommend bringing socks to help you slide and pivot on the floor. And of course, bring water to stay hydrated!

What are the benefits of Pole Dancing?
Pole dancing builds muscle, tones your core, burns calories, increases flexibility, releases endorphins, improves your coordination, increases self- esteem and honestly, it’s just really fun!

I’m not strong or flexible can i still do pole ?
Yes! Pole dance is an individual experience and you start at your own level. Pole dance is for everyone regardless of size, athletic ability, or strength. You do not need to have any dance experience to start. Our classes will help you to build strength, fluidity, embrace body awareness and foster a sense of personal accomplishment.
